In these cases, I unfortunately find the best approach to be to wrap the examples in `if (interactive()) ` to ensure that they will not be ran on CRAN tests machines. It hampers the checks of CRAN but it makes it possible to get usable code to users. On Sun, Dec 3, 2023 at 9:54 AM Artur Araujo wr
